Hi All! I recently purchased a 2005 IS250 that has parking sensors. They seem to be extremely sensitive and there is no button that I can see to mute this or adjust. I cant see any issues with the bodywork that can cause this issue - there is a tiny chip on one of the sensors but I am not sure if this could be the cause or not? ( I can add pics shortly)

I know some models have the 'radar' display to show but my model doesn't. It seems to happen/beep when both stationary and moving. 

I guess my query is - is there a button/switch to mute this that I am missing? Or if not, how simple/expensive is it to replace the chipped senor or add in a button to be able to mute etc?

Of course it could be a sensor detecting vehicle or pedestrian movement near the car.

However, in a cluster next to the steering wheel, you may have a button with a large P on it, which appears to be transmitting to a small cone!  This switches the parking assist sensor system on and off.

Personally, I find the system very useful.  Considering the age of the car, you may well find one or more of the sensors have corroded so they operate erratically.

I expect a good auto electrician can check the sensors to see if this is the case.
